The whole concept of the Google page rank toolbar has been rather de-valued over the last two years. Paid links selling has without doubt ruined what was once a very interesting rating from Google. This has resulted in many high traffic and powerful websites being given a page rank toolbar penalty. This leads to a new debate; should the Google page rank toolbar be replaced by another tool such as the Google page strength toolbar?

I personally have a number of websites to do with offering cheap hotel deals, jobs in foster care and composite doors – I have to say that I really do not care about page rank these days.

So what would this page strength rank represent? Well to answer this question we need to start by looking at what is wrong the current page rank toolbar. Many webmasters believe that a website has two actual page rank values, one that you see on your toolbar and one that is its real value that is only available to certain people within Google itself. Why the two ratings? Well I suppose Google are attempting or hoping that people will not continue to purchase text links on a site if the page rank they see on the toolbar is lowered.

I would like to see a two colour page rank system but with a websites true pr value being shown. Again with seroundtable it would show a page rank six in a red colour. This red colour shows danger, it shows the public that the site does pass on “link juice” which would indicate that it has been penalised. If your site passes this all important link juice then it could have a green colour – if the webmaster was then thought to be selling this “juice” then that green colour could turn red.
